10 GCA § 50117
Hearings
View official PDF ↗(a)Any person who receives an order from the Administrator as authorized by this Chapter and any person whose license, certification, permit, registration or Notice of Arrival is disapproved by the Administrator may, within fifteen
(15)days of the date of receipt of such order or disapproval, file a Notice of Intent to appeal with the Board, setting forth in such notice a verified petition outlining the legal and factual basis for such appeal.
(b)The Board of Directors shall, not more than sixty
(60)calendar days after receipt of such Notice of Appeal, hold a public hearing at which time the appellant may appear and present evidence in person or through counsel in support of this petition.
(c)The Agency is hereby authorized to administer oaths, examine witnesses and issue subpoenas to compel the attendance of witnesses and the production of evidence relevant to the matter involved in the hearing.
(d)The Board shall affirm, modify or revoke any action which is appealed and shall notify the appellant of its decision not more than thirty
(30)calendar days after the conclusion of the hearing. Such notice shall be in writing and shall state the reasons for the decision.
(e)Any person may appeal such decision to the Superior Court of Guam by filing with the Agency a written notice of such intent to appeal within ten
(10)days of the notice in subsection
(d)of this Section and shall have a transcript of the proceedings upon request and payment of the expense of preparation and certification of the transcript, and filling out a petition with the Superior Court of Guam within thirty
(30)days of the notice in subsection
(d)of this Section.
